Last week the Championships Committee of the World Boxing Association issued a letter to Gennady Golovkin (35-0, 32 KOs), who holds the WBA's middleweight crown, advising him that under the rules of the WBA he must request special permission from the sanctioning body before getting into the ring with IBF welterweight champion Kell "Special K" Brook (36-0, 25 KOs) on September 10 at the O2 Arena in London.
